Max celebrates Christmas in July



On the first Sunday in July, Max went to a Christmas party.

The people at the party explained that in other countries around the world it is very cold at Christmas time. As July can be very cold in Australia, some people who once lived in these countries, like to get together to remind them of a cold Christmas.



Max was excited when he saw the the turkey. It was very big. (Max didn't eat any. He preferred the bananas.)
